French brand Look is marking 30 years since Greg Lemond won the Tour de France on its KG86 carbon frame with a limited edition 795 Aerolight and Keo Blade 2 pedals.

Just 200 of the Look 795 Aerolights will be available in a finish that seems to nod towards the famous La Vie Claire jersey of that era.

It includes Look’s Epost 2 seatpost, Aerostem stem, ADH handlebar, HSC8 Aero fork with integrated brakes, and its Zed3 chainset. You also get Look Keo Blade 2 30th Anniversary limited edition pedals, and Mavic Cosmic Pro Carbon SL C wheels.

The price is £8,299, so you’d better check your pockets for change.

Look is also offering the Keo Blade 2 30th Anniversary pedals mentioned above for sale separately, through independent bike dealers only. 

The carbon-bodied pedals come with two blade tensions and are available with either titanium (£259.99) or cromoly (£164.99) axles. They are delivered with grey (4.5°) cleats and two pairs of socks (one white pair, one black pair).
